PA-9018-M
WS Speicification : A5.5 E9018-M
JIS Specification : NONE
Other Specification: NONE
I. APPLICATIONS:
Welding of 60kgf/mm2 class high tensile strength steel for pressure vessels, bridges, penstocks, vehicles, offshore constructions vehicles and machinery. Fillet tack welding of T1, HY80, HY90 steels.
II. DESCRIPTIONS:
PA-9018-M is an iron powder low hydrogen type electrode for all-position welding, which provides good notch toughness of weld metal at low temperature. The usability and X-ray soundness of weld metal are good in all-position welding.
III. NOTES ON USAGE:
-
Dry the electrodes at 300-350ºC for one hour before use.
-
Adopt back step method or strike the arc on a small steel plate prepared for this particular purpose because arc striking on the base metal is in danger of initiating cracking.
-
Keep the arc as short as possible.
-
Preheat at 80-100°C before use.
-
Pay attention not to exceed proper heat-input because excessive heat-input causes deterioration of impact values and yield strength of weld metal.
